Casa Munras Garden Hotel & Spa is a Spanish-style property in Monterey's heritage district offering a comfortable base near Old Town. Guests frequently praise the plush bedding and the Spanish-inspired Mediterranean dishes at Estéban Restaurant. However, entry-level rooms run noticeably small, and the immediate commercial surroundings lack the picturesque charm found elsewhere on the peninsula. 14127

What travelers noticed
- Guests consistently praise the on-site dining at Estéban Restaurant, highlighting Spanish-inspired tapas enjoyed by the indoor fireplace or outdoor patio firepit. 123
- Beds earn high marks across reviews for their plush mattresses, high-quality linens, and soft pillows. 2
- Bathrooms receive positive feedback for details like Spanish-style tiling, granite countertops, and deep soaking tubs or walk-in showers. 214
- Staff members are regularly commended for quick check-ins and helpful, personalized recommendations for exploring Monterey. 23
The catch
- Reviewers disagree on the location: some enjoy being an easy walk from downtown and a block from the city transit center, while others note the immediate area near a Denny's lacks the beauty and charm of coastal Monterey. 14
- Opinions on room dimensions also vary depending on the tier, as 505-square-foot junior suites provide generous sitting areas, but entry-level rooms run small. 143
